Image showing the text CVS is a debilitating condition characterized by episodes of severe nausea and persistent vomiting. These episodes can last hours to even days. The cause of CVS is unknown, but it can often be managed with lifestyle changes and medications. Hope starts here. Link to www.cvsanordic.net
